How much do full time controller real estate j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time controller real estate in the United States is $119,497.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$97,000.00 and $138,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Full Time Controller Real Estate vs Bookkeeper Real Estate?

AspectFull Time Controller Real EstateBookkeeper Real Estate
CredentialsCPA or equivalent, accounting degreeHigh school diploma or associate degree
Work EnvironmentCorporate office, finance departmentOn-site or remote, small business setting
ResponsibilitiesFinancial reporting, budgeting, complianceData entry, transaction recording
Industry UsageUsed in larger real estate firms and corporationsCommon in small real estate businesses

The Full Time Controller Real Estate typically handles comprehensive financial management, requiring advanced credentials and working in larger corporate environments. In contrast, a Bookkeeper Real Estate focuses on basic transaction recording, often in smaller firms with less formal credentials. The controller's role is more strategic and supervisory, while the bookkeeper's role is more operational and clerical.

Role Overview

We are seeking a detail-oriented and experienced Controller Real Estate Portfolio to oversee complex accounting functions, ensure the accuracy of financial reporting, and contribute to strategic financial planning. The ideal candidate will bring strong GAAP knowledge, excellent analytical skills, and experience in real estate or property management accounting.

Key Responsibilities

Financial Reporting & Month-End Close

  • Prepare and review mon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ements in compliance with GAAP.
  • Lead month-end and year-end close processes, ensuring accuracy and timeliness.

General Ledger & Journal Entries

  • Maintain and reconcile general ledger accounts.
  • Prepare complex journal entries and account reconciliations.

Accounts Payable & Receivable Oversight

  • Supervise and support AP/AR functions, ensuring accuracy of invoicing, rent rolls, lease accounting entries, and cash application.

Budgeting & Forecasting

  • Support annual budgeting process and periodic forecasting.
  • Analyze variances and provide insights on trends.

Audit & Compliance

  • Assist with external audits, tax filings, and internal control reviews.
  • Ensure compliance with financial policies, lease accounting standards (ASC 842 preferred), and statutory requirements.

Process Improvement

  • Identify opportunities to streamline accounting workflows and enhance internal controls.

Qualifications

Required

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field.
  • 5+ years of progressive accounting experience.
  • Strong proficiency in Excel and accounting software (experience with real estate systems a plus).
  • Solid understanding of GAAP and internal controls.
  • Excellent analytical, organizational, and communication skills.

Preferred

  • CPA or working toward CPA designation.
  • Experience in real estate, property management, or commercial leasing accounting.
  • Familiarity with lease accounting and property management systems.
